summaryrefslogtreecommitdiffstats
path: root/abs/core
diff options
context:
space:
mode:
authorBritney Fransen <brfransen@gmail.com>2016-12-20 02:55:29 (GMT)
committerBritney Fransen <brfransen@gmail.com>2016-12-20 02:55:29 (GMT)
commitfad7b3a009934bae753e989294aa29af5e9b658b (patch)
treeb2d64a71dff1b494deb21af7f5f4162e5ad5f160 /abs/core
parentec446a3a8bf9d90b9b6cd90bde043ed73f8f9c07 (diff)
downloadlinhes_pkgbuild-fad7b3a009934bae753e989294aa29af5e9b658b.zip
linhes_pkgbuild-fad7b3a009934bae753e989294aa29af5e9b658b.tar.gz
linhes_pkgbuild-fad7b3a009934bae753e989294aa29af5e9b658b.tar.bz2
LinHES-config: plymouth_config.py: make sure v86d is before plymouth in mkinitcpio.conf
Diffstat (limited to 'abs/core')
-rwxr-xr-xabs/core/LinHES-config/PKGBUILD4
-rwxr-xr-xabs/core/LinHES-config/plymouth_config.py13
2 files changed, 9 insertions, 8 deletions
diff --git a/abs/core/LinHES-config/PKGBUILD b/abs/core/LinHES-config/PKGBUILD
index a3096f0..7ecd615 100755
--- a/abs/core/LinHES-config/PKGBUILD
+++ b/abs/core/LinHES-config/PKGBUILD
@@ -1,6 +1,6 @@
pkgname=LinHES-config
pkgver=8.4.2
-pkgrel=3
+pkgrel=4
conflicts=(MythVantage-config MythVantage-config-dev LinHES-config-dev LinHes-config )
pkgdesc="Install and configure your system"
depends=('bc' 'libstatgrab' 'mysql-python' 'expect' 'curl' 'dnsutils' 'parted'
@@ -191,5 +191,5 @@ md5sums=('97b810ddc35d1f441dbe8cdd6886e2af'
'3866086e6af5e3528a66eff492f2f4dd'
'c9279fa095af624ee3d9bc75d3328360'
'02cf69074d2bbacef05fa3e451af9af3'
- '10354854c29d894d3598639eaa1df72c'
+ '18a47236637c364af27c14ac0aafc801'
'7acbd2064db905e76372a0618b24a6d9')
diff --git a/abs/core/LinHES-config/plymouth_config.py b/abs/core/LinHES-config/plymouth_config.py
index bb60722..a3ade2b 100755
--- a/abs/core/LinHES-config/plymouth_config.py
+++ b/abs/core/LinHES-config/plymouth_config.py
@@ -120,14 +120,16 @@ class plymouth_driver():
add_modules = ['i915']
remove_hooks = ['v86d']
else:
- #add_modules = ['nfs','jm']
- remove_modules = ['i915']
- add_hooks = ['v86d']
+ #add_modules = ['nfs','jm']
+ remove_modules = ['i915']
+ #remove and add to ensure v86d is first
+ remove_hooks = ['v86d','plymouth']
+ add_hooks = ['v86d','plymouth']
- new_hooks = self.add_hooks(add_hooks , new_hooks)
new_hooks = self.remove_hooks(remove_hooks, new_hooks)
- new_modules = self.add_modules(add_modules, new_modules)
+ new_hooks = self.add_hooks(add_hooks , new_hooks)
new_modules = self.remove_modules(remove_modules, new_modules)
+ new_modules = self.add_modules(add_modules, new_modules)
self.new_hooks = new_hooks
self.new_modules = new_modules
@@ -156,7 +158,6 @@ class plymouth_driver():
if line.startswith('MODULES='):
new_line = 'MODULES="%s"'%(" ".join(self.new_modules))
f.write(new_line)
- f.write("\n")
f.close()
except:
print " plymouth_config: couldn't write %s" %conf_file